Hyundai Inster Standard Range EV charger: which one is the best fit?

The Hyundai Inster Standard Range can charge at home at up to 11 kW using a three-phase connection. This determines the best choice for your situation: an 11 kW EV charger makes full use of the Inster’s charging capacity, while a faster 22 kW charger provides no additional charging speed because the car cannot accept more than 11 kW. Charging specifications of the Hyundai Inster Standard Range

SpecificationValue
Battery capacity42 kWh (39 kWh usable)
Maximum AC charging power at home11 kW (three-phase)
Range (WLTP)327 km
Charging time with an 11 kW EV chargerapprox. 4.5 hours
Charging connectorType 2
DC fast chargingup to 73 kW

How long does it take to charge the Hyundai Inster Standard Range?

The usable battery capacity is 39 kWh. Using an 11 kW EV charger, you can charge the battery from empty to full in approximately 4 to 4.5 hours, including charging losses. If you connect the car at 23:00 in the evening, it will be fully charged well before the morning. A single-phase connection provides no more than 3.7 kW, increasing the charging time to more than ten hours. A three-phase connection combined with an 11 kW EV charger is therefore the smart choice for this Inster.

The Inster uses a Type 2 charging connection, just like most modern EV chargers. At home, you can charge using either the fixed cable or the Type 2 socket on the charger. Always have the electrical connection installed by a qualified installer. This is safer and can also be important for your insurance coverage.

Frequently asked questions

Does the Hyundai Inster Standard Range require a three-phase connection?

A three-phase connection is required to achieve the full 11 kW charging capacity. With a single-phase connection, the charging power is limited to 3.7 kW, which significantly increases the charging time. When your home does not yet have a three-phase connection, you can request an upgrade from your grid operator.

Why is a MID meter important for the Inster Standard Range?

A MID-certified kWh meter accurately records the electricity used during each charging session. This is particularly important when charging costs need to be reimbursed by an employer, leasing company or your own business. In the Netherlands, a compatible charger with a MID meter may also be used for ERE registration. ERE certificates are only applicable in the Netherlands.
